WebMay 21, 2024 · Florey and his colleague E. B. Chain transformed what was a bacteriological curiosity into a clinical tool of immense value, and in so doing they opened up the new industry of antibiotic production. WebSep 28, 2024 · In 1945 Fleming, Florey and Chain received the Nobel Prize in medicine. Howard Florey has also been recognised many ways in Australia. There is a Canberra suburb named Florey, his likeness was on the 50-dollar note from 1973 to 1995 and there are a number of university research schools and fellowships named in his honour.

Died: 21 February 1968, Oxford, United Kingdom. … chuck berry pulp fiction songChain was born in Berlin, the son of Margarete (née Eisner) and Michael Chain, a chemist and industrialist dealing in chemical products. His family was of both Sephardic and Ashkenazi Jewish descent. His father emigrated from Russia to study chemistry abroad and his mother was from Berlin. In 1930, he received his degree in chemistry from Friedrich Wilhelm University.
